Anthony, the CA fin grip is not NY approved. It still conspicuously protrudes. Whether or not the shooter can wrap a hand around the grip is immaterial. A fin grip works for California because their law defines a pistol grip as a grip that allows your hand to be at a certain angle and plane, allows the thumb to wrap around, and some other nonsense qualifiers. NY has no definition so in the end, it is a pistol grip with a piece of kydex attached to it. Sorry, but that's the way it is.
